Court Dimensions and Design



To make sure ideal gameplay and adherence to laws, the dimensions and format of pickleball courts need to be thoroughly specified. A standard pickleball court determines 20 feet in width and 44 feet in length for both songs and doubles play. The suggested layout includes a non-volley area, typically referred to as the "kitchen area," expanding 7 feet from the internet on either side. This area is crucial, as it affects player positioning and shot option - Illinois and midwest.


The web elevation is established at 36 inches at the sidelines and 34 inches at the facility, developing a small dip that influences sphere trajectory. Court markings are equally vital; lines must be 2 inches large and unique in shade to make sure visibility.


Additionally, a barrier area surrounding the court is a good idea, typically prolonging 5 to 10 feet past the sidelines these details and baselines to suit players' movements and boost security. Correct design and measurements not just make sure conformity with official laws yet likewise improve the overall having fun experience, accommodating both leisure and competitive play. Mindful planning in these locations is critical to the effective construction of pickleball courts.


Surface Product Options



Choosing the right surface area material for pickleball courts is critical for guaranteeing optimal player efficiency and security. The option of surface area can considerably affect gameplay, including ball bounce, traction, and player convenience.


There are numerous options offered, each with its unique qualities. Asphalt is a preferred option due to its toughness and reduced upkeep demands. It provides a solid playing surface area that can hold up against different climate conditions but might require periodic resurfacing.


Concrete is an additional extensively used material, supplying excellent durability and a smooth coating. It enables for consistent ball bounce yet can be tough on gamers' joints, making it less preferable for long-term play without appropriate cushioning.


For those seeking enhanced convenience and shock absorption, cushioned acrylic surfaces present a feasible choice. These surface areas integrate a base layer with an acrylic overcoat, giving improved traction and a softer feel, which is helpful for lowering the threat of injuries.


Finally, synthetic turf is getting grip, specifically for multi-purpose centers. Its adaptability and lower upkeep requires make it an appealing choice, though it may not give the exact same round feedback as conventional tough courts. Mindful consideration of these options will certainly guarantee an optimal having fun environment.


Drain and Lights Factors To Consider



Correct water drainage and efficient lights are necessary components in the building and construction of pickleball courts, substantially influencing both playability and security. Ample drain systems protect against water accumulation, which can cause slippery surfaces and damage to the court framework. A properly designed water drainage plan integrates sloped surfaces and ideal products to facilitate water move far from the playing area - Illinois and midwest. This not only preserves the stability of the court yet also reduces downtime as a knockout post a result of poor climate condition.




Lighting is equally important, particularly for courts meant for night usage. Correct lighting boosts exposure, making certain that gamers can see the sphere clearly and reducing the danger of accidents. The placement of lights fixtures must be purposefully intended to get rid of shadows and give even distribution of light across the court. LED lights are recommended for their power effectiveness and long life, supplying bright lighting while decreasing operational expenses.
